
...Heywood worked hard all his life. Even with a football scholarship to [USC], he took a job as a busboy at a sorority...
...A two-way end...a captain on the 1943 USC team...played just five games before being drafted...
...played professional football for the Chicago Rockets, Detroit Lions...returned...to serve in Korea in 1952...to command the 26th Marine Regiment in Vietnam, making him the only player in NFL history to serve in three wars...the Naval Attaché to the Dominican Republic...An accomplished horseman...a black belt in karate and trained jet pilot...acted in some movies, played tennis with Charlton Heston...and a golfing buddy of Bob Hope...
Also, Ralph Heywood, 85; former USC end later served as a Marine - LA Times
